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Wash the Spinach

    Thoroughly rinse the fresh spinach under cold running water to remove any dirt or grit. Drain well and set aside.

  2. 2

    Prep the Vegetables

    Halve the cherry tomatoes and thinly slice the red onion. Mince the garlic cloves and set all the vegetables aside.

  3. 3

    Prepare the Dressing

    In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and black pepper. Adjust seasoning to taste.

Cooking

  1. 4

    Sauté the Spinach

    In a large skillet over medium heat, add a tablespoon of olive oil. Once hot, add the minced garlic and s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ant. Add the spinach and sauté until wilted, about 2-3 minutes.

  2. 5

    Combine Ingredients

    In a large mixing bowl, combine the sautéed spinach, cherry tomatoes, and red onion. Drizzle with prepared dressing and toss gently to combine.

  3. 6

    Add Feta

    Crumble the feta cheese over the top of the salad and gently mix to incorporate without breaking the cheese too much.

  4. 7

    Final Touch

    Squeeze the juice of the lemon over the salad for extra flavor and toss lightly one last time.
